Atchison County, Kansas Electricity Overview

Atchison County has no power production sources and must import all of the electricity consumed in the county.

While the national average residential rate of electricity sits at 16.02 cents per kilowatt hour, Atchison County's average rate is 13.33% below that at 13.88 cents per kilowatt hour.

Atchison County has the 1937th worst pollution level due to electricity use in the nation and 29th highest in the state, releasing 79,755,864.92 kilograms of CO2 gases.

Atchison County has a population of 16,382 citizens.

The largest supplier in Atchison County by megawatt hours sold is Evergy.

Atchison County ranks 31st out of 105 counties in the state for total electricity usage, with its residents consuming over 200,000 megawatt hours.

Atchison County, Kansas Net Metering

About 75.00% of the electricity companies in Atchison County offer net metering to their consumers. At the state level, Kansas has poor net metering and feed in tariff regulations.

Energy Loss

Energy loss in Atchison County is about 3.56% of the total energy transmitted by the 2 companies that operate in the county and also report energy loss. The national average energy loss is 2.87%. This earned Atchison County a rank of 57th best in Kansas out of 105.
